Hopeless and Probable
Opposite meaning words
Hopeless
Hopeless adjective - Incapable of being solved or accomplished.
Usage example: keeping this desk organized is hopeless
Probable
Probable adjective - Worthy of being accepted as true or reasonable.
Usage example: the counselor could find no probable reason for the girl's bizarre actions
